As the heart of global luxury and fashion, France is undergoing a disruptive material revolution, with bio-based leather emerging as a frontrunner. Crafted from natural renewable resources such as plant fibers, agricultural waste, or fungal mycelium, bio-based leather features natural plant/fungus bases, zero plastic, and high biodegradability. While delivering a texture that rivals genuine leather, it significantly reduces carbon footprints. Company Profile: Vegskin is a highly watched material innovation enterprise in France, focusing on developing vegan leather using waste fibers from fruits like bananas and mangoes. Based on local circular agriculture, its main selling point is its 100% biodegradable, ultra-eco-friendly profile.
Core Technical Advantages: The company uses bio-enzymatic methods to extract crude fibers from tropical fruits and agricultural waste. While preserving the natural network structure of plant fibers, it applies non-toxic natural resins for curing. The material contains absolutely no petrochemical plastics and can completely degrade in natural soil within a short period, resulting in a very low carbon footprint.
Best Application Scenarios: Perfect for independent French designer brands focused on absolute sustainability, pop-up concept store accessories, eco-friendly packaging, and sustainable footwear lines. Its unique natural fiber texture serves as an excellent storytelling medium for eco-conscious brands.
Sourcing Highlights: Due to limited early-stage capacity, the company currently mainly supplies small-batch custom sheets and cannot provide stable, bulk industrial rolls. OEM accessibility is tailored toward specific co-branded projects, making it a great marketing tool to elevate a brand's green image.
Company Profile: Hailing from Italy and making a massive impact in French luxury circles, Vegea transforms grape skins and seeds discarded during the winemaking process into high-quality grape-based vegan leather through industrial composite technology.
Core Technical Advantages: Its core technology involves dehydrating, drying, and crushing grape pomace, then mixing it uniformly with bio-based polyurethane (Bio-PU). By adapting modified processes from traditional synthetic leather production lines, Vegea successfully achieved continuous mass industrial production, ensuring highly stable physical properties and a fine, delicate texture.
Best Application Scenarios: Thanks to its mature capacity and excellent physical performance, it is widely utilized in mid-to-high-end French bag and footwear mass production lines, as well as eco-friendly interior concept cars for well-known automotive brands, serving as a perfect alternative to traditional animal leather.
Sourcing Highlights: Fully supplies standardized industrial bulk rolls with high commercial availability. It supports large-scale OEM processing for downstream brands, but its openness to deep formula customization is relatively limited, primarily focusing on supplying products from its existing standard catalog.
Company Profile: Sqim (under its brand Ephea) is the absolute leader in European fungal mycelium materials. By "growing" leather from fungi on specific substrates, the company has established long-term, exclusive co-development relationships with luxury giants such as France's Kering Group.
Core Technical Advantages: The company masters cutting-edge, pure biological cultivation technology for fungal mycelium. By controlling temperature, humidity, and nutrient substrates, the fungal mycelium naturally weaves into a high-density, 3D network structure. Its cell walls possess inherent natural toughness, allowing it to mimic the unique texture of luxurious suede without requiring any plastic.
Best Application Scenarios: Target targeted at the pinnacle of luxury fashion—such as haute couture apparel, limited-edition luxury handbags, and custom footwear. Given its pure biotech attributes and premium cost, it is the ultimate choice for showcasing a brand's forward-looking technology and sustainable luxury.
Sourcing Highlights: Completely unable to provide bulk rolls; supplied only in biologically cultivated sheets of fixed dimensions. It does not accept general OEM requests, as its current capacity is heavily prioritized for top French luxury groups that have signed exclusive partnership agreements.
